SUN WOO MORNING CLAIMS THAT THE WLFI SUIT CONCERNS THE PRINCIPLE OF CHAIN OWNERSHIP
On 22 August, Sun Woo, the founder of the Wave, wrote that his lawsuit against World Liberty Financial appeared to be a commercial dispute involving $45 million and 4 billion coins, but in substance related to the principle of the establishment of block chains. He pointed out that the industry was based on “your key, your currency”, i.e. everyone could really own their assets without a permit. According to Sun, the case exposed the right of the other party to be secretly embedded in the contract to freeze the user ' s assets at will, without disclosure, without governance and without procedures, and to use it for several days with its currency unlocked. In his view, that would be contrary to the name of “freedom”, and if the issuer could seize the holder's assets at any time, the block chain would be no different from the old world. He will proceed to the end of the proceedings, not only to recover assets, but also to establish a precedent in the Tribunal that “your assets must really belong to you”。
